Night Shift stopped turning on automatically on your Mac
Night Shift scheduling sometimes breaks in macOS. Go to System Settings → Displays → Night Shift and toggle the schedule off and back on. That re-activates it within 30 seconds.
Night Shift is supposed to warm your screen at night to reduce blue light. Sometimes the scheduling feature stops working even though the setting looks fine. Re-enabling the schedule fixes it. If that doesn't work, there's a conflict with another app or a screen profile overriding Night Shift.

Skip, I just want a technicianCommon mistakes to avoid
- Thinking Night Shift is broken when it's just the schedule that's disabled. The feature still works, you just need to toggle it
- Setting the wrong time for the schedule. Sunset to Sunrise is easiest
- Forgetting to check if the time and timezone on your Mac are correct
